About

Dr. Habib Badran is a leading researcher at the intersection of artificial intelligence, the Internet of Things (IoT), and autonomous robotic systems. His work focuses on developing intelligent, machine-learning-driven solutions for critical infrastructure monitoring and industrial automation. Dr. Badran’s most notable contribution is his pioneering work on a machine-learning-based and IoT-enabled robot swarm system for autonomous pipeline crack detection. This research addresses a pressing challenge in urban infrastructure management, replacing dangerous and labor-intensive human inspections with coordinated, intelligent robot teams. His 2024 paper on this topic has already garnered significant early attention, reflecting the high demand for scalable, autonomous monitoring technologies. By integrating real-time sensor data with advanced ML algorithms, Dr. Badran’s systems enable rapid, accurate detection of structural faults, potentially preventing catastrophic failures and reducing maintenance costs. His work is foundational for the next generation of smart city infrastructure, where resilient, self-monitoring networks are essential. With a growing citation impact and a clear focus on real-world applications, Dr. Badran is establishing himself as a key innovator in applied robotics and intelligent infrastructure.
